Yiddish[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Old High German -isc, from Proto-Germanic *-iskaz (compare German -isch), from Proto-Indo-European *-iskos.

Suffix[edit]

־יש (-ish)

  1. -ish, -ic, -y (for an adjective)
  2. -ian (for an adjective)
  3. -ish, -ese (for a language name or demonym)
